Nabil el-Khoury

Summary

Nabil el-Khoury is a human[1]. His place of birth was Mtaileh[2]. He was born on April 5, 1941[3]. He worked as a philosopher[4], translator[5], university teacher[6], and theologian[7]. Education

Educated at Saint Joseph University of Beirut[11], a Catholic university[28], in Lebanon[29], founded in 1875[30]; Pontifical Urbaniana University[12], a pontifical university[31], in Italy[32], founded in 1627[33]; and University of Tübingen[13], a comprehensive university[34], in Germany[35], founded in 1477[36], headquartered in Tübingen[37]. Doctoral advisors include Walter Schulz[14], a philosopher[38], 1912–2000[39], of Germany[40], awarded the Order of Merit of Baden-Württemberg[41] and Benedict XVI[15], a Latin Catholic priest[42], 1927–2022[43], of Germany[44], awarded the Commander of the Legion of Honour[45], specialised in Christian theology[46].

Career and Affiliations

Recorded occupations include philosopher[4], translator[5], university teacher[6], and theologian[7]. Nabil el-Khoury was employed by Lebanese University[10].

Recognition

Nabil el-Khoury received the Ratzinger Prize[16].

Personal Life

Nabil el-Khoury's religion is recorded as Maronite Church[17].
